    Why are there suds in my Cafe CDT800?
    • L
      Lisa PerrySep 15, 2025
      Suds in your Café dishwasher tub usually indicate the wrong detergent was used. Use only high-quality automatic dishwasher detergents like Cascade® Platinum™ ActionPacs™ or Finish® Quantum® Automatic Dishwashing Detergent. If suds are present, open the dishwasher and let them dissipate. Then, open the door, press and hold Start for 3 seconds, and close the door. Also, be careful not to spill rinse agent and always wipe up any spills immediately.

    How to turn off the beeping at the end of the cycle on my Cafe CDT800 Dishwasher?
    • D
      David RodriguezSep 12, 2025
      The beeping at the end of the cycle on some Cafe dishwasher models is normal. To turn off the double beep indicator (or re-activate it if it was previously turned off), press the Dry pad 5 times within 3 seconds. A triple beep will sound to indicate the end-of-cycle beep option has been turned on or off.

    Why does my Cafe Dishwasher not fill with water after I press start?
    • D
      Deanna SanchezSep 10, 2025
      If the control panel responds to inputs but your Cafe dishwasher never fills with water, check the following: * Ensure the door is firmly closed. * Make sure the water valve (usually located under the sink) is turned on. * The flood float may be stuck. Remove the Ultra-Fine filter and lightly tap the piece under the ultra fine filter that looks like a salt shaker. Replace the filter.

    How to clean stained tub interior in Cafe Dishwasher?
    • H
      Heather FordSep 4, 2025
      For a stained tub interior in your Café dishwasher, especially if there's a white film, it's likely due to hard water minerals. Café recommends using high-quality rinse agents such as Cascade® Platinum™ Power Dry™ Rinse Aid or Finish® Jet-Dry® Rinse Aid to help prevent these deposits. To remove existing mineral deposits, run the dishwasher with citric acid (Part number: WD35X151, order through GE Appliances Parts) or use Cascade® Platinum™ Dishwasher Cleaner or Finish® Dishwasher Cleaner, following the label directions.
